Read this excerpt from "Eavesdropping" by Eudora Welty and answer the question. What they talked about, I have no idea … . It wa
deff fn [24]

Answer:

<u>Option B. The words "What I felt" best establish immediacy in the above excerpt.</u>

Explanation:

In the excerpt from "Eavesdropping" written by Eudora Welty, the author establishes immediacy in the story line by the use of words such as "What I felt." Immediacy is defined as the quality of bringing into a direct involvement with something, which gives a right sense of some sort of urgency. In literature immediacy is used to state directness and a lack of an intervention agent within the plot. When using words such as "What I felt" the reader is getting the direct and immediate perception of the character rather than a washed-out observation.
